Application

1,4-addition catalyst; used with disulfides for the thioetherification of alcohols; acylation catalyst; used to prepare active esters.

Jing-Yu Wu et al.
The Journal of organic chemistry, 73(22), 9137-9139 (2008-10-24)
Aziridines underwent cyclization reaction with carbon disulfide and isothiocyanate in the presence of organophosphine to afford thiazolidinone derivatives in good to high yields. The mechanistic study revealed that organophosphine serves as a catalyst in the reaction.
